Al Campbell is a distinguished director recognized for his contributions to various television comedies. He is particularly celebrated for his role as the iconic character Barry Shitpeas in Charlie Brooker's critically acclaimed series, including Screenwipe, Newswipe, Weekly Wipe, and Year Wipes.
